From the box: A game about communal living. We try to develop a happy, complete village. There are hardships and opportunities. There are Bad Feelings to handle with Love and Forgiveness. The Meeting hall is the heart of the community. If we succeed in building a community, we all win together. A medium-complicated game that explores both material and spiritual values. The Game of Community: the non-competitive game based on the principle of co-operation. Build a community together, work through hardships together, develop your resources together. Play together, not against each other. Players cooperate in this draw-cards-and-move game, moving around a track, collecting resources and trying to supply enough resources to recreation, industry, necessities, education and inner life to create a complete community. The game also uses event cards including love, unity, work, plain-speaking and bad feeling cards, which players accumulate. Depending on which variants are used, the players can lose, unlike some co-operative games. This can happen if the players don't have any resources to pay for a harmful event, or if all the players are immobilized. Players: "4 are ideal, but more or less can certainly play and sometimes a very exciting game can be played with ten."
